If you're considering employing an exterminator take a few steps to guide you to choose the most suitable pest control company for your home.
Read third-party customer reviews. One of the first steps in choosing the right exterminator is to read its reviews on websites of third parties like Yelp, Google Reviews, or the Better Business Bureau. Beware of businesses with low overall ratings that have a higher percentage of negative reviews than positive ones.
Request quotes and talk to representatives. Many companies can provide quotes for general pest control services over the phone to provide you with an estimate of how much you'll pay based on your specific situation. We suggest calling several service providers and making notes on what they offer, and also asking questions about their guarantees.
Review custom pricing and plan options. Once you have several quotes, you can compare these prices, treatment frequency as well as the overall plan coverage offered.
Plan an initial visit. After you've narrowed down the most suitable option for you, set your appointment for a time that's most convenient for you. If you're looking to have an exterminator come out on your property, a lot of businesses offer same-day service provided they have technicians on call.
Pest Control Costs according to Pest Type
While you could expect to be paying between $400 to $950 a year for general, full-service pest control, based upon the estimates we've received from various exterminators, your costs could differ if you're searching for an exterminator who can perform an targeted pest control service.
It's difficult to predict how much you'll have to pay for each pest, as the majority of treatments will be part of a comprehensive pest control program. But, based on data from HomeAdvisor, which collects costs information from its extensive network of partner contractors, below are some average prices for exterminators for every kind of pest:
Ants: $100-$500
Bed bugs: $300-$5,000
Cockroaches: $100-$400
Fleas: $75-$400
Lice: $50-$200
Mosquito: $100-$500
Moths: $150-$300
Rodents: $150-$500
Scorpions: $50-$300
Silverfish: $100-$300
Spiders: $100-$200
Termites: $2,000-$8,000
Ticks: $200-$500
